I have a question where exactly to put the language files. There are so many folders within DMS and I am unsure which one to use. I am using a child theme, and perhaps I have to many folders since I have upgraded this site a few times. But i need to get this straight.

 

To day I downloaded my site locally and installed another child them. Of course my language "se" was gone. And another question why can't i reverse to my second child theme after activating another one?

 

Here are all my language folders

 

Wp_content/language    here is one

Wp_Content/themes/dms/language   here is another 

WP_content/themes/dms/dms/language    one more...

Wp_Content/themes/dms/childtheme/language  one more....

Wp_content/plugin/pageline-customize/language

 

Which one should I use??

 

And I probably have one more because the live site still works and I have copied all the above to the local

and that is still eng.

Hi Peter,

 

You do not need to use the Customize Plugin if you're using a child theme, as they do the same thing. Therefore, I recommend you stick with the child theme and remove the customize plugin, but be sure to make a copy of any CSS or custom code you have added to that plugin.

 

In-regards to where you place your language files, you will want to add these to your child themes language folder. If you add them to your DMS language folder, it will remove any additional files when there is an update.

 

Also, not sure what you mean by reverse to your other child theme ? Are you saying you have two child themes active for the same theme ?
